Pea stone installation services involve spreading and leveling small, rounded stones to create a durable, attractive surface for various outdoor areas. This process typically starts with preparing the ground by removing any existing debris or unsuitable material. Then, a base layer is often installed to ensure stability and proper drainage. The pea stones are evenly distributed and compacted to form a smooth, permeable surface that can be used for pathways, driveways, garden beds, or decorative accents around a property.
This type of installation helps address common problems such as poor drainage, soil erosion, and weed growth. When water tends to pool or runoff excessively on a property, pea stone surfaces allow for better water absorption and runoff management. Additionally, the permeable nature of pea stones reduces the risk of puddling and mud, making outdoor spaces safer and more accessible. It also acts as an effective weed barrier when combined with proper edging or landscaping techniques, helping to keep garden beds tidy and low-maintenance.

The overview below groups typical Pea Stone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Asheville,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or pea stone repairs or touch-ups,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for small areas or patchwork projects.
Basic Installation - Installing pea stone for a standard residential pathway or small yard area generally costs between $600 and $1,500. Most projects in this category stay within this range, depending on size and site conditions.
Full Property Covering - Covering larger areas such as driveways or extensive landscaping with pea stone can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Complete Renovation or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ive pea stone installations for multiple areas or commercial properties can exceed $5,000, with many projects in this tier being more customized and complex, leading to hig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of using pea stone for landscaping projects? Pea stone provides a natural, attractive appearance and good drainage, making it a popular choice for pathways, gardens, and decorative features in Asheville and nearby areas.
How do local contractors prepare the ground for pea stone installation? Contractors typically clear the area, level the surface, and add a base layer of gravel or sand to ensure proper drainage and stability for pea stone applications.
Can pea stone be used around plants or in garden beds? Yes, pea stone is often used as a mulch or ground cover around plants to help retain moisture and control weeds while adding a decorative touch.
What maintenance is involved with pea stone installations? Maintenance generally includes occasional raking to redistribute the stones and removing debris or weeds that may grow through the material.
Are there different types or colors of pea stone available locally? Yes, local service providers can offer various colors and sizes of pea stone to match specific aesthetic preferences or landscape designs.
